Модераторы: gambit
  

Поиск:

Ответ в темуСоздание новой темы Создание опроса
> Запрос на обновление, Запрос на обновление в LINQ 
V
    Опции темы
belousov
Дата 8.2.2009, 21:22 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: нет
Всего: 6



Доброго времени суток. 

Подскажите как выглядит запрос на обновление в LINQ? Тот который в SQL называется UPDATE))))

 smile 


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
HalkaR
Дата 8.2.2009, 22:32 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Пуфыстый назгул
****


Профиль
Группа: Экс. модератор
Сообщений: 2132
Регистрация: 8.12.2002
Где: В Москве

Репутация: нет
Всего: 42



Такого нет. Есть метод InsertOrUpdate, если объект уже в базе то будет выполнен update.
PM MAIL   Вверх
belousov
Дата 8.2.2009, 22:34 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: нет
Всего: 6



HalkaR, а ну хотя б так. ща попробуем

Добавлено через 5 минут и 54 секунды
а я чего то такого метода не нахожу... он как находиться?


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
belousov
Дата 9.2.2009, 13:19 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: нет
Всего: 6



Может я выразился не так, скажу по другому


Как с помощью LINQ обновить данные в таблице???


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
HalkaR
Дата 9.2.2009, 13:32 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Пуфыстый назгул
****


Профиль
Группа: Экс. модератор
Сообщений: 2132
Регистрация: 8.12.2002
Где: В Москве

Репутация: нет
Всего: 42



Цитата(belousov @  8.2.2009,  22:34 Найти цитируемый пост)
а я чего то такого метода не нахожу... он как находиться? 

Сорри неправильно сказал, для обновления данных в бд надо просто вызвать DataContex.SubmitChanges
PM MAIL   Вверх
belousov
Дата 9.2.2009, 13:39 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: нет
Всего: 6



HalkaR, я че так и не допираю, а причем тут это? у меня ж данные в таблице есть, я их поменять хочу. 

А SubmitChanges это же подтверждение. Или я здесь не прав?


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
PashaPash
Дата 9.2.2009, 14:23 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Эксперт
***


Профиль
Группа: Завсегдатай
Сообщений: 1233
Регистрация: 3.1.2008

Репутация: 4
Всего: 49



belousov, LINQ to SQL следит за объектами, которые ты через него получил. Изменил объект - сделал запрос на обновление. Вызвал SubmitChanges - выполнил запрос.


--------------------
PM MAIL WWW   Вверх
belousov
Дата 9.2.2009, 14:42 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: нет
Всего: 6



Цитата(PashaPash @  9.2.2009,  14:23 Найти цитируемый пост)
Изменил объект - сделал запрос на обновление.


Вот как изменить объект то? и потом запрос на обновление сделать перед  SubmitChanges


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
WarHog
Дата 10.2.2009, 14:53 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Шустрый
*


Профиль
Группа: Участник
Сообщений: 122
Регистрация: 20.10.2007
Где: Воронеж

Репутация: 1
Всего: 2



belousov, например
Код

SomeTable.SomeField = SomeValue;
SomeTable.SubmitChanges();

--------------------
PM MAIL   Вверх
belousov
Дата 15.6.2009, 12:19 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 317
Регистрация: 21.11.2006
Где: Москва

Репутация: нет
Всего: 6



Всем спасибо, вопрос решен. забыл отписаться. 


--------------------
NIHIL VERUM EST LICET OMNIA 
PM MAIL WWW ICQ Skype   Вверх
  
Ответ в темуСоздание новой темы Создание опроса
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ей)
0 Пользователей:
« Предыдущая тема | LINQ (Language-Integrated Query) | Следующая тема »


 




[ Время генерации скрипта: 0.0718 ]   [ Использовано запросов: 21 ]   [ GZIP включён ]


Реклама на сайте     Информационное спонсорство

 
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ности     Powered by Invision Power Board(R) 1.3 © 2003  IPS, Inc.